Sometimes there is back end money for dealer when bike is sold. Plus there are financial points when dealer finances through banks and even more when financed through HD. And then there is the extended warranties that create mega profit. On most purchases, the dealer seizes the moments and gets you to buy all the 300% profit items plus the $95.00 per hour to install them and sells you the benefit that your payment will only go up a couple bucks a month and this is the best part, the installed items at dealer are cover under the original manufactures warranty. So bottom line, the dealer will make you feel like a million bucks for saving you tons of money but in reality dealer has made a bushel basket full of money off you. And then the dealer will top it off by giving you for free a shirt or hat. SO keep in mind that the bike was free you paid $20,000 plus for that hat or shirt as dealer goes to the bank with tremendous profit off deal................

Well your always better off selling it yourself.But who knows how long that will take,and will you want to be bothered by dreamers who can't even obtain financing.When I sold cars(for 19 years) if someone was going to factory order a car,which took 6-8 weeks,I would ask them,do you want to spend more than 6-8 weeks trying to sell your car?Usually they said no,so I would lock them in by having them sign a contract saying they would pay a certain amount with or without a trade.So if they got lucky,and found someone to pay up for their trade they came back with more money,if not,we had already reached a with trade deal.I can't recall a single person coming back having sold their car themselves.
